In a critical update for the Kansas City Chiefs, head coach Andy Reid has indicated plans to continue coaching until at least 2026, despite ongoing retirement speculation due to his age and the current roster's uncertainties.

The Chiefs are currently navigating the challenging situation of quarterback Patrick Mahomes being sidelined, moving former Samford QB Chris Oladokun to the active roster ahead of their Week 16 matchup against the Tennessee Titans.

As the Chiefs prepare for this game, they are focused on overcoming their struggles, acknowledging that despite their record, the Titans present a significant challenge. Additionally, the Chiefs made several roster moves on Saturday, which included three players coming off the 53-man roster, indicating a proactive approach to bolster their lineup.

Meanwhile, tight end Travis Kelce has dismissed retirement rumors, emphasizing his commitment to the remaining games this season. With the organization also monitoring the implications of coaching candidate Matt Nagy potentially leaving for the Titans, the Chiefs are in a period of transition, preparing for both immediate challenges and future prospects, including the upcoming 2026 NFL Draft.
